@petersuber I'll certainly give Mozilla, Inc. one cheer for reversing addons.mozilla.org's moratorium for Russian users on extensions able to circumvent Russian censorship.
But, you know who would get three out of three?
Anyone who starts keeping a persistent Firefox patchset permitting any user to control the browser's extension API keyring, and thereby to access extensions they (or someone they trust) signed, instead of only those Firefox extensions Mozilla, Inc. permits.
The real problem isn't monarchial errors; it's the monarchy.
My copy of ungoogled-chromium lets me load any extension I wish locally, without an online "store's" cryptographic signing permission. Why doesn't Firefox (outside of beta and developer releases, per https://stackoverflow.com/questions/31952727/how-can-i-disable-signature-checking-for-firefox-add-ons)?
From 2004 to 2016, Debian Project reacted to Mozilla's unacceptable "Distribution Partners" conditions (https://lwn.net/Articles/676799/) by maintaining a high quality unbranded browser version named Iceweasel -- until Mozilla, Inc. relented.
Mozilla, Inc.'s extensions monopoly, IMO, shows Iceweasel's proper time not only has come again but never ended. As Kipling (and Poul Anderson) said, "No truce with kings."
(Amended 2024-06-27 to suggest LibreWolf as a best-compromise path forward for Gecko/Quantum-based browsing, alongside Blink-based ungoogled-chromium.)
